08/03/2010 - SECRETARY OF STATE UNVEILS COMMEMORATIVE STONE ON NEW LEIGH HEALTH CENTRE

SECRETARY OF STATE UNVEILS COMMEMORATIVE STONE ON NEW LEIGH HEALTH CENTRE

Andy Burnham, Secretary of State for Health and MP for Leigh, unveiled the foundation stone for the new Leigh Health Centre on Friday 5th March 2010.

The event is to commemorate the building work that is now under way on the Leigh Infirmary site.

This is a major health development for Leigh and the surrounding area and patients are set to benefit from a fantastic new development of local health services.

The main building construction began in 2009, and the new Health Centre is due to open in early autumn.

The LIFT scheme is expected to be the first phase of a wider development of the Leigh Infirmary site involving the Primary Care Trust, Wrightington, Wigan and Leigh NHS Foundation Trust, Wigan Metropolitan Borough’s Adult Services and 5 Boroughs Specialist NHS Trust.

The scheme will represent an £11m investment in state-of-the-art facilities for primary care and community services, and key elements include:

• Replacing the existing Grasmere Street and College Street
health centres
• Walk-in centre, physiotherapy department and other services
currently delivered at Leigh Infirmary
• New 4 chair dental suite
• New integrated Children’s Centre
• Specialist Weight Management Service
• Adult Sexual Health Services

Commenting on the foundation stone unveiling, PCT Chairman, Alan Stephenson, said, “We are absolutely delighted that the Secretary of State has agreed to add his name to this major health development in Leigh. Work is progressing well on site to provide these much needed modern facilities. Anyone who has used the LIFT buildings in other parts of the Borough will know just how good they are and the wide range of services that can be offered to local people from them.”

Andy Burnham MP said, “Today we can celebrate another significant milestone in the delivery of new health facilities across the Leigh area. The LIFT scheme has been a tremendous success and will benefit the local community enormously when it is completed."

“I am sure when this new facility is completed it will be yet another local example of a high quality ‘state of the art’ health centre providing excellent care to patients as well as a modern working environment for staff.”

22/12/2009 - New Year, new rights for patients in Leigh

New Year, new rights for patients in Leigh

Andy Burnham MP has welcomed new legal rights for patients that will come into effect in 2010.

The two new rights coming in from April are; seeing a cancer specialist within 2 weeks if your GP suspects you may have cancer. And all treatment, for any illness, should be within 18 weeks of GP referral.

Andy Burnham MP said, “In 2010 the Government is going to give more real power to patients. With legally enforceable rights for patients. This is a big step forward for patient rights and puts a lot more power in your hands."

“It will mean that, by law, if our local NHS Trust cannot meet these guarantees they will have to find you somewhere which can treat you as soon as possible. Even if it is in the private sector."

“I want to go even further than these guarantees. I support the Government's cancer pledge which is to give people the legal right to get tested for cancer and get results within one week of seeing your GP. And we also want to bring in the right to see a GP at weekends or in the evening, and to abolish practice boundaries for good."

“With this new power behind them, patients can be certain that they will receive the same high standards of care. This is about real power for patients in the Leigh area.”
